Сохранить публичный объект на диск
Сохраняет публичный объект на ваш диск
- Параметры
- Расширенный вызов ?
Функция СохранитьПубличныйОбъектНаДиск(Знач Токен, Знач URL, Откуда = "", Куда = "") Экспорт
| Параметр | CLI опция | Тип | Обяз. | Назначение |
|---|---|---|---|---|
| Токен | --token | Строка | ✔ | Токен |
| URL | --url | Строка | ✔ | Адрес объекта |
| Откуда | --from | Строка | ✖ | Путь внутри публичного каталога (только для папок) |
| Куда | --to | Строка | ✖ | Путь сохранения файла |
Возвращаемое значение
Соответствие Из КлючИЗначение - сериализованный JSON ответа от Yandex
| Параметр | Описание |
|---|---|
| proxy | ИнтернетПрокси или структура полей Протокол, Сервер, Порт, Пользователь, Пароль, ИспользоватьАутентификациюОС |
| timeout | Таймаут выполнения запроса |
| adv_response | Оформляет ответ в виде полной структуры HTTP-ответа с полями code, body и headers |
| retries | Число попыток отправки HTTP-запроса при коде 5** или внутренних ошибках клиента |
| dontwait | Создает фоновое задание и возвращает его данные (только для 1С и OneScript) |
Пример использования для 1С:Предприятие/OneScript
Токен = "y0__xCOranuBRj1uTsgs8z_iRV...";
URL = "https://yadi.sk/d/n0QfpfP48V7piQ";
Результат = OPI_YandexDisk.СохранитьПубличныйОбъектНаДиск(Токен, URL);
- Bash
- CMD/Bat
oint yadisk СохранитьПубличныйОбъектНаДиск \
--token "***" \
--url "https://yadi.sk/d/qtVSIFkGc9NQPQ"
oint yadisk СохранитьПубличныйОбъектНаДиск ^
--token "***" ^
--url "https://yadi.sk/d/qtVSIFkGc9NQPQ"
Результат
{
"path": "disk:/Загрузки/44705505-412c-4473-a9e5-0fd63bbc4d53.png",
"type": "file",
"name": "44705505-412c-4473-a9e5-0fd63bbc4d53.png",
"created": "2026-05-26T17:42:51+00:00",
"modified": "2026-05-26T17:42:51+00:00",
"size": 2114023,
"mime_type": "multipart",
"md5": "9e0176f87f6565a22f78e0f9b39a4d78",
"sha256": "89f8eb42a35208a17c85036e17237b0aa0657e1841efa6171dc5acbc0dea9e18",
"media_type": "image",
"resource_id": "1573541518:ac24958d8e5e1d9497cc2585fdfb01d7c1de70aafd2c618d6cc429d508b7b346",
"revision": 1779817371604223,
"comment_ids": {
"public_resource": "1573541518:ac24958d8e5e1d9497cc2585fdfb01d7c1de70aafd2c618d6cc429d508b7b346",
"private_resource": "1573541518:ac24958d8e5e1d9497cc2585fdfb01d7c1de70aafd2c618d6cc429d508b7b346"
},
"exif": {},
"antivirus_status": "clean",
"file": "https://downloader.disk.yandex.ru/disk/439e88e9353d666842025dba4d1254cd2dc4e754019846860490e161918c7..."
}